Scott James Ward (born 5 October 1981) in the London Borough of Brent, is an English former professional footballer who played as a goalkeeper for Luton Town in the Football League. Ward signed professional terms for Luton Town on his 17th birthday and while making his first team debut saved a penalty with his first touch in League football against Brentford.[1] He had several periods in and out of the professional game, which involved a time at Plymouth Argyle.[citation needed]

He is the brother of professional footballers Darren and Elliott Ward.[1]
